summ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/target/trx_toolkit/burst_fwd.py5
1 files changed, 5 insertions, 0 deletions
diff --git a/src/target/trx_toolkit/burst_fwd.py b/src/target/trx_toolkit/burst_fwd.py
index 746b2814..6e79d44f 100644
--- a/src/target/trx_toolkit/burst_fwd.py
+++ b/src/target/trx_toolkit/burst_fwd.py
@@ -326,6 +326,11 @@ class BurstForwarder:
if msg is None:
return None
+ # Timeslot filter
+ if msg.tn not in self.ts_pass_list:
+ print("[!] TS %u is not configured, dropping UL burst..." % msg.tn)
+ return None
+
# Path loss simulation
msg = self.path_loss_sim_ul(msg)
if msg is None: